November 2022 in “Cosmetics” This study observed that SY red pericarp rice extract promotes hair growth, inhibits 5α-reductase, and enhances hair regeneration in mice, with the extract being safe from cytotoxicity and irritation, indicating its potential as a natural hair growth promoter.

January 2026 in “Annals of Clinical Endocrinology and Metabolism” This narrative review summarizes evidence on NAD⁺ biosynthesis and turnover, highlighting that while NAD⁺ precursors like NR and NMN consistently boost NAD⁺ levels in preclinical and human studies, clinical outcome results remain varied, indicating a need for more standardized human trials.
June 2026 in “International Science Journal” This study reviewed recent advances in regenerative technologies for aesthetic and reconstructive medicine and found that adipose-derived stem cells and platelet-rich plasma are well-established for tissue repair due to their safety and effectiveness, while emerging technologies like exosome-based therapies hold future potential.
